The mean average value of alternating current (or emf) during a half, cycle is given by \[{{I}_{m}}=0.636\,{{I}_{0}}\] (or \[{{E}_{m}}=0.636{{E}_{0}})\] During the next half cycle, the mean value of ac will be equal in magnitude but opposite in direction. For this reason the average value of ac over a complete cycle is always zero. So the average value is always defined over a half cycle of ac.You need to login to perform this action.
